Ludacris’ little girl has discovered one of his biggest hits.
On Thursday, the rapper, 46, shared a video of daughter Chance, 2, standing on a table as wifeEudoxie Bridges, 37, records her.
“Chance!” Eudoxie says as she slyly smiles and continues to dance.
“Can you get out the way et descends?” she then asks the toddler, who continues singing the line as mom asks her to get off the table in French.
“When Yo Daddy Is Ludacris 😎,” he captioned the funny video.
“We are all wondering in the house who [played] this song for her,” Eudoxie commented. “Everyone is saying it wasn’t them lol.”

In addition to Chance, Ludacris and Eudoxie also share daughter Cadence, 8. He is also dad to Cai, 9, and Karma, 21, from previous relationships.
In May, Ludacris chatted with PEOPLE aboutbeing the ultimate girl dad. He said that life as a girl dad is “absolutely amazing” and has filled him with gratitude for the lessons his daughters have taught him.

In May, all four of his daughters were on deck to watch the actor and musician be honored with a star on theHollywood Walk of Fame.
Ahead of the birth of his fourth daughter in 2021, Ludacrisopened up to PEOPLEabout fully and unabashedly embracing his role as a girl dad.
“The more girls I had, the more I tried to be a protector,” he said at the time. “I want to make sure that I prepare them for the world. I’m teaching them financial literacy. They’re learning piano around here. They’re learning ballet. They’re learning great manners because as we all know, great manners can get you places money can’t. I just want them to have a variety of assets and a lot of confidence.”
“I also want to make sure that they don’t get their hearts broken,” he added, “and if they do, that I’m the first person they come crying to.”
